A gas chromatog.-mass spectrometry (GC-MS) method was used to analyze chem. components in hot melt adhesives from composite packaging. The separated peaks were identified by mass spectral library searching combined with retention index comparison. Sixty-two chem. components were identified from hot melt adhesives, and the chem. compounds were mainly composed of esters, hydrocarbons, acids, aldehydes and ketones. The relative deviation of this method was less than 2.6%. The qual. result of this method was reliable and realizable. This established method can be used for further study of chem. components in hot melt adhesives.
